  • Descrição: Racemization is the key step to turn a kinetic resolution (KR), which suffers from the well‐known drawback of being limited to a maximum yield of 50% with high enantiopurity, into a dynamic kinetic resolution (DKR) process. Enzyme‐based racemization of enantiopure alcohols and amines has gained significant interest in recent years. This review covers recent advances in enzyme‐based racemization approaches and their potential applications in bi‐enzymatic DKR.
